Burleson’s big night lifts Cedar Bluff past Coosa Christian, 35-7

Staff Reports

GADSDEN – Cedar Bluff senior quarterback Jacob Burleson turned in another stellar performance on the football field at Class 1A, Region 7 rival Coosa Christian on Friday night.

Burleson ran for 235 yards on 21 carries and scored four touchdowns. He also connected on 6-of-13 pass attempts for 58 yards in the Tigers’ 35-7 victory.

Nick Clifton added 54 yards on 10 carries with a touchdown for the Tigers (6-3), who finished region play undefeated at 6-0.

Cedar Bluff also had five interceptions in the game, one each from Aden Green, Bucky Leek, Hunter Stallings, Kade Browning and Clifton.

The Tigers close out the regular season this Thursday at home against Cherokee County rival Sand Rock before hosting Woodland in the Class 1A state playoffs on Nov. 5.

Coosa Christian (4-5, 3-3) closes out its regular season at home on Friday against Whitesburg Christian.
